  • Livvey Rurup III

    We went on a Sunday at brunch time, there was about a twenty minute wait which we didn’t mind as they had coffee and waters available. We started with a Cuban OJ which is OJ, rum, and banana liqueur. It was pretty good. They have chicory coffee which is strong and delicious. Their biscuits are HUGE. Try and not get filled-up with that. Their portions are very generous. We shared a pecan waffle which comes with strawberries, bananas, candied pralines, and whipped cream on top. We also had the Eggs New Orleans which was absolutely wonderful. It comes with grits/potatoes. The eggs we’re poached perfectly. Being a recent transplant from the Deep South we sought this place out for something, we will definitely be frequenting here.
